I am a Salesforce developer and I have been asked for a particular task which is related to exploring different platforms for the task of building custom enterprise applications. How can I explain Force.com to someone unfamiliar with it? 

Answered by Chloe Burgess

In the context of Salesforce, force.com is a cloud-based platform that is provided by Salesforce platform for building and deploying custom business applications. It offers a comprehensive set of tools and even services for application development, including database management, user Interface customization, business logic implementation, and integration with other systems.

One of the main key components of force.com is the Salesforce lightning platform, which can provide a powerful set of development tools that include:

Database services

Force.com can provide a robust relational database management system which is known as Salesforce object query language which allows users to create, and store in the Salesforce database.

User interface customization

Try developers can design and even customize user interfaces by using the lightning Components framework which would provide a rich set of pre-built Components for building responsive and interactive user interfaces.

Security and Compliance

Force.com can offer enterprise-grade security features which can include user authentication, role-based access control, data encryption, and compliance with industry standards and even regulations.
